A water stop is rarely convenient when you are tabbed up, working a range day, moving through woodland or managing a full daysack. The hydration bladder vs bottle decision comes down to how you carry load, how often you need to drink and how easily you can maintain the system. Both have a proper place in field kit. Choosing the right one means fewer interruptions, better water discipline and less avoidable weight movement on the march.
Hydration bladder vs bottle: the operational difference
A hydration bladder is a flexible reservoir carried inside a pack or dedicated carrier. Water reaches you through a drinking tube, usually routed over the shoulder strap. Its main advantage is access: you can take small, regular drinks without taking off your pack or breaking stride.
A bottle is a rigid container carried in a side pocket, webbing pouch or utility pouch. It is simple, hard-wearing and easy to inspect. You have to stop or at least free a hand to use it, but it can be filled, cleaned and shared with little fuss.
For military, tactical and outdoor use, neither option is automatically superior. A bladder generally supports steady hydration during sustained movement. A bottle is often the more dependable choice for short tasks, vehicle work, cold conditions and any situation where cleaning facilities are limited.
When a hydration bladder earns its place
A bladder is particularly useful when your pack stays on for long periods. On a loaded walk, endurance event, navigation exercise or extended hill day, reaching for a bottle repeatedly can become inconvenient enough that people simply drink less than they should. A tube at the shoulder keeps water available while you keep moving.
Most reservoirs hold between 1.5 and 3 litres. That capacity suits a daysack with internal hydration routing, and the weight sits close to the back rather than hanging from the sides. A properly filled bladder can also reduce sloshing compared with a half-full bottle, provided you expel excess air before closing it.
The practical benefit is not just speed. Frequent small drinks are usually easier to manage than waiting until you are properly thirsty. This matters during long patrols, tabbing, fieldcraft training, cycling and warm-weather work, when dehydration can affect concentration and physical output before it becomes obvious.
A bladder also leaves external pack pockets clear for items you may need more urgently: waterproofs, gloves, a brew kit, rations, map case or first-aid equipment. If your daysack has a separate hydration sleeve, the reservoir is protected from the rest of your load and can be removed without unpacking everything.
Limits of a bladder system
The same concealed position that makes a bladder tidy can make it harder to manage. You cannot always see how much water remains, especially in a dark pack or covered carrier. Some reservoirs have volume markings, but they are of limited use once the bladder is stowed. Checking water level usually means stopping and opening the pack.
Refilling can be slower too. A wide opening is much easier to fill from a tap or water container than a narrow screw cap, but requires space and care to avoid wetting the inside of your pack. If water treatment tablets or powder are being used, ensure they are fully dissolved and that the reservoir is compatible with them.
The tube and bite valve need routine attention. Mud, dust and grit can reach the mouthpiece, particularly when it is left exposed. A bite-valve cover is worthwhile for field use, and the tube should be routed where it will not snag on vegetation, weapon slings, doorways or vehicle fittings. In freezing conditions, residual water in the tube can freeze before the reservoir does. Blowing water back into the bladder after drinking can help, but a bottle carried inside the jacket may still be the better answer in severe cold.
Where a water bottle is the stronger choice
A water bottle is uncomplicated kit. You can see it, count it, refill it and clean it without specialist brushes or drying racks. For many users, that simplicity outweighs the convenience of hands-free drinking.
Rigid bottles work well in side pockets and webbing pouches, where they can be reached by a team-mate or taken out quickly at a halt. They are also better suited to mixing electrolyte drinks, carrying hot water where the bottle is rated for it, or filling a cooking pot. A metal bottle can have additional uses around camp, although it must only be heated when it is designed for that purpose and with the lid removed.
For short-duration training, dog walking, airsoft, range use, vehicle-based work or a day where you expect regular stops, a bottle is often all that is required. Two one-litre bottles also give useful redundancy. If one leaks, cracks or is lost, you still have water available.
Bottles are easier to protect against contamination. You can keep the cap on, wipe the drinking surface and inspect the interior before filling. They are also easier to dry fully after use, which matters if your kit is stored between exercises or used intermittently.
The compromise with bottles
The drawback is accessibility under load. A bottle buried in a daysack is no use until you stop. Even in a side pocket, it can be awkward to retrieve while wearing a large pack or body armour. If drinking requires a deliberate halt every time, water intake can become irregular.
Bottle weight may also sit away from the centre of the back, especially if only one side pocket is used. This is not a major concern with a single small bottle, but it can affect balance on uneven ground when carrying heavier loads. Use matched bottles on both sides where your pack layout allows it, or secure them in webbing pouches close to the body.
Capacity, load carriage and water planning
Start with the duration and conditions, not the container. A cool three-hour walk and a hot all-day navigation exercise require very different water plans. Physical effort, temperature, wind, altitude, access to refill points and the salt content of your food all affect what you need to carry.
As a working approach, many people carry a minimum of two litres for a full day outdoors, then adjust upwards for heat, exertion and lack of resupply. This is not a substitute for local guidance or a proper risk assessment. In exposed ground or on an extended route, carry the capacity to manage delays rather than relying on a water source that may be dry, inaccessible or unsuitable to drink.
A 2-litre bladder gives a clean, compact setup for moving under load. However, pairing it with a smaller bottle is often the more sensible field arrangement. The bladder covers drinking on the move; the bottle provides a visible reserve, a vessel for treated water or drinks mixes, and a practical option if the bladder develops a fault.
For a short outing, one or two bottles may be more efficient than carrying a reservoir, tube and cleaning kit. For a long route with regular movement, a bladder plus backup bottle is hard to beat. Think of the bottle as more than spare water. It is a separate, easily handled water source when you need to measure, mix, share or refill without opening the pack.
Cleaning and maintenance matter more than brand preference
A neglected hydration bladder can develop unpleasant tastes, mould or bacterial growth. Empty it after use, rinse it with warm water and allow the reservoir, tube and bite valve to dry completely. Purpose-made cleaning brushes are useful because the tube is the part most likely to stay damp. Do not store a bladder sealed while wet.
If you use flavoured drinks or electrolytes, clean the system promptly. Plain water is easier on a reservoir, while bottles are generally the better choice for strong mixes. Follow the manufacturer’s guidance for cleaning tablets and avoid harsh chemicals that may damage seals or leave residue.
Bottles need care as well, particularly around threads, caps and drinking spouts. A wide-mouth design is easier to scrub and dry. Check for cracked caps, worn seals and damage caused by being dropped or crushed in a vehicle. A bottle that leaks inside a pack can ruin maps, communications kit and spare clothing just as effectively as a failed bladder.
Before heading out, inspect the bladder for pinholes, check the quick-release connection if fitted, and make sure the bite valve shuts properly. With bottles, confirm that the cap is secure and that the pouch or side pocket retains it when you run, climb or negotiate obstacles.
Choose for the task, then build in a reserve
Choose a hydration bladder when sustained movement and hands-free drinking are the priority. Choose bottles when simplicity, easy cleaning, hot drinks, visible water levels or cold-weather reliability matter most. For many field users, the practical answer is not either-or but a primary reservoir supported by one accessible bottle.
Good water carriage should fit your pack, your activity and the conditions rather than follow a trend. Set your system up before the day starts, test it under load, and make drinking part of your routine long before thirst forces the issue.
